概括
海洋细菌提供了有前途的定数感知抑制剂 (QSI),可以在不杀死细菌的情况下对抗传染病和抗菌素耐药性 (AMR). 对海洋QSI的进一步研究对于开发新的治疗方法至关重要.

背景情况:
- 传染病是一个主要的威胁,由通过定数感应 (QS) 形成的细菌生物膜驱动.
- 抗菌素耐药性 (AMR) 复杂化了治疗,需要新的治疗策略.
- 定数感应抑制剂 (QSI) 提供了一种方法,可以在不促进AMR的情况下解除细菌的作用.

主要成果:
- 海洋细菌是各种QSI (例如QQ酶,) 的大部分未开发资源.
- 与其他自然资源相比,目前对海洋QSI的研究是有限的.
- 了解分子机制和使用现代工具对于有效应用至关重要.
结论:
- 海洋细菌具有针对QS的新型抗感染剂的巨大潜力.
- 对海洋QSI的进一步调查是有必要的,以应对AMR日益增长的威胁.
- 整合先进技术将促进基于海洋细菌的治疗方法的发展.

Gene Regulation in Microbial Communities: Quorum Sensing
545
Quorum sensing is a mechanism of bacterial communication that enables coordinated gene expression in response to changes in population density. This facilitates collective behaviors that enhance survival, resource acquisition, and ecological adaptation. This process relies on small signaling molecules called autoinducers that accumulate as bacterial populations grow.
